1. Neutral Colors

Neutral colors are a classic choice for small kitchen walls. Shades like beige, taupe, and ivory can create a clean and timeless look that will never go out of style. These colors are perfect for those who want a subtle and understated backdrop for their kitchen. They also pair well with almost any other color, making them versatile and easy to work with.

Small Kitchen Wall Paint Color Idea The first thing to consider when choosing a wall paint color for your small kitchen is the size and layout of the space. Lighter colors tend to make a room feel more spacious, while darker colors can make a room feel smaller and more cramped. Therefore, it is important to choose a color that will open up the space and create a sense of airiness. Neutral colors such as white, beige, and light gray are great options as they reflect light and make the room feel brighter and more open. Another factor to keep in mind is the style of your kitchen. Warm colors like yellow, orange, and red can add a cozy and inviting feel to the space, while cool colors like blue and green can create a calming and serene atmosphere. If you have a modern kitchen, consider using bold and vibrant colors like teal or navy blue to add a pop of color and personality. For a traditional kitchen, soft pastel shades like pale pink or mint green can add a touch of elegance and charm.

Maximizing Space with Color Combinations

small kitchen wall paint color idea If you want to add more depth and dimension to your small kitchen, consider using a combination of colors. Contrasting colors like black and white or navy blue and white can create a striking and visually appealing look. Analogous colors like shades of blue or green can create a harmonious and cohesive design. You can also use monochromatic colors by choosing different shades of the same color to add interest and variation to your kitchen walls. In addition to the color itself, you can also use different painting techniques to create visual effects in your small kitchen. Stripes can make a room appear taller, while diagonal lines can create the illusion of more space. Sponging or ragging techniques can add texture and depth to the walls. Just be sure to use these techniques sparingly in a small kitchen to avoid overwhelming the space.
